Covering the entire spectrum of this fast-changing field, Diagnostic Imaging: Nuclear Medicine, Fourth Edition, is an invaluable, everyday resource for nuclear medicine physicians, general radiologists, and trainees-anyone who requires an easily accessible, highly visual reference on today’s rapidly changing nuclear medicine therapies. Drs. Jennifer Schroeder, Joanna R. Fair, and a new team of highly specialized authors provide up-to-date information in concise yet detailed chapters to help you make informed decisions at the point of care. They address the most appropriate nuclear medicine options available to answer specific clinical questions within the framework of all imaging modalities, making this edition a useful learning tool as well as a handy reference for daily practice. - Reflects recent advances in the field with information on new FDA-approved imaging agents, new therapeutic agents, updates to available therapies and procedures with new interval data and guidelines, new imaging protocols, including perfusion-only examinations for evaluation of pulmonary embolisms, and more
- Features new and expanded information throughout, including treatment of progressive metastatic castrate-resistant prostate cancer, benign and malignant thyroid disease, sentinel node mapping, lymphedema, and pediatric nuclear imaging
- Contains 20+ new chapters on pheochromocytoma, paraganglioma, thyroid incidentaloma, adult fever of unknown origin, malignant peripheral nerve health tumor, paraneoplastic syndrome, and many more
- Features 2,000 high-quality print images (with an additional 500 images in the included eBook), many of which are new or updated, including pediatric imaging, oncologic imaging, radiologic images, full-color medical illustrations, and 3D renderings
- Covers the physics behind nuclear medicine with safety considerations for both patients and radiologists with new material on radiopharmaceutical IV infiltration
- Uses bulleted, succinct text and highly templated chapters to help you make informed decisions at the point of care
- Includes an eBook that allows you access to everything in the print version as well as additional images, text, and references, with the ability to search, customize your content, make notes and highlights, and have content read aloud; additional digital ancillary content may publish up to 6 weeks following the publication date
